A kind of Demountable blade component
Technical field
The utility model relates to the technical field of soy bean milk making machine parts, especially relates to a kind of Demountable blade component.
Background technology
At present, soy bean milk making machine is widely used.The crushing knife of the soy bean milk making machine on the existing market generally is riveted joint or is welded on the machine shaft, can not free-handly take off, and easy like this causing cleaned the dead angle, and the accident of crushing knife incised wound hand occurs easily, has potential safety hazard.
The Chinese patent notification number is that CN201374989Y discloses a kind of dismountable soybean milk maker cutter, comprises that soy bean milk making machine and motor for soymilk cabin extend to the motor shaft in the cup body of soymilkgrinder, and the motor shaft end sets firmly reducing mechanism by retaining mechanism.Wherein, the snap close piece that is threaded on the axle head screw rod of retaining mechanism by reducing mechanism suit motor shaft forms.And snap close piece is the nut that reducing mechanism is set in the motor shaft end screw rod and is spirally connected with this screw rod.Although this soybean milk maker cutter is detachable, solved the cleaning Dead Core Problems of general crushing knife of soymilk machine on the market, but its retaining mechanism processed complex, its snap close piece that is threaded the snap close tension probably occurs and need to be by the situation of instrument dismounting, so still there is the problem of dismounting inconvenience in this soybean milk maker cutter.

The specific embodiment
Below in conjunction with the specific embodiment the utility model is further described.
Such as Fig. 1 to the embodiment that Figure 7 shows that the utility model Demountable blade component, comprise cutter shaft 10 and blade 20, blade 20 is by riveting or being fixedly welded on the blade holder 30, cutter shaft 10 upper ends are provided with spire 11, blade holder 30 is provided with screw-thread bush 31, and blade holder 30 is fixed on cutter shaft 10 by the spiral of spire 11 with screw-thread bush 31.In the present embodiment, spire 11 is the flat axle of fried dough twist, and screw-thread bush 31 is the shaped grooved screw-thread bush of a word.Wherein, the diameter of the diameter of the flat axle of fried dough twist and the shaped grooved screw-thread bush of a word is suitable, makes the fit structure of the two more reliable and more stable.
In order to stop the axially-movable of blade holder 30, blade holder 30 is provided with support member with the bearing of cutter shaft 10, and supports support blade holder 30 also limits its position.Wherein, support member and cutter shaft 10 are one-body molded.Support member also can be jump ring 40, and jump ring 40 cooperates with stopper slot on being located at cutter shaft 10.Employing jump ring 40 cooperates as support member with stopper slot, and cutter shaft 10 need not to make a boss specially and supports, and processing cost is low, and is easy to use.The jump ring 40 of present embodiment is E type jump ring.
This Demountable blade component is by being provided with screw-thread bush 31 in blade holder 30, cutter shaft 10 spirals that make it to be provided with the upper end spire 11 cooperate, utilize blade 20 self gravitations and this fried dough twist formula structural design, make blade holder 30 overcome pressure angle to realize the spiral assembling of blade holder 30 and cutter shaft 10, when blade 20 rotation, because its direction of rotation is opposite with the hand of spiral of spire 11, so blade 20 can revolve more fastening and more fastening and can not fly out.Simple and the easy cleaning of this structure processing need not just can realize dismounting by work, is user-friendly to.
